-
Notifications
You must be signed in to change notification settings - Fork 4.5k
/
PolicyQuerySettings.cs
39 lines (34 loc) · 2.03 KB
/
PolicyQuerySettings.cs
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
// Copyright (c) Microsoft Corporation. All rights reserved.
// Licensed under the MIT License.
// <auto-generated/>
#nullable disable
using System;
namespace Azure.ResourceManager.PolicyInsights.Models
{
/// <summary> Parameter group. </summary>
public partial class PolicyQuerySettings
{
/// <summary> Initializes a new instance of PolicyQuerySettings. </summary>
public PolicyQuerySettings()
{
}
/// <summary> Maximum number of records to return. </summary>
public int? Top { get; set; }
/// <summary> OData filter expression. </summary>
public string Filter { get; set; }
/// <summary> Ordering expression using OData notation. One or more comma-separated column names with an optional "desc" (the default) or "asc", e.g. "$orderby=PolicyAssignmentId, ResourceId asc". </summary>
public string OrderBy { get; set; }
/// <summary> Select expression using OData notation. Limits the columns on each record to just those requested, e.g. "$select=PolicyAssignmentId, ResourceId". </summary>
public string Select { get; set; }
/// <summary> ISO 8601 formatted timestamp specifying the start time of the interval to query. When not specified, the service uses ($to - 1-day). </summary>
public DateTimeOffset? From { get; set; }
/// <summary> ISO 8601 formatted timestamp specifying the end time of the interval to query. When not specified, the service uses request time. </summary>
public DateTimeOffset? To { get; set; }
/// <summary> OData apply expression for aggregations. </summary>
public string Apply { get; set; }
/// <summary> Skiptoken is only provided if a previous response returned a partial result as a part of nextLink element. </summary>
public string SkipToken { get; set; }
/// <summary> The $expand query parameter. For example, to expand components use $expand=components. </summary>
public string Expand { get; set; }
}
}